Yuzu Soda

 Yuzu Soda

Yuzu soda is a light, citrusy drink made with Japanese yuzu juice, sweetener, and sparkling water. It's tangy like lemon with a floral twist — bold, refreshing, and beautifully aromatic.


Ingredients (Serves 2)

  • 2 tablespoons yuzu juice (fresh or bottled)

  • 1–2 tablespoons honey, agave syrup, or sugar (to taste)

  • 1½ cups chilled sparkling water or soda water

  • Ice cubes

  • Lemon or yuzu slices and mint, for garnish


Instructions

  1. Mix Yuzu and Sweetener
    In a small pitcher or bowl, stir together the yuzu juice and sweetener until fully dissolved.

  2. Assemble the Drink
    Fill two glasses with ice. Divide the yuzu mixture evenly between them.

  3. Add Sparkling Water
    Top each glass with sparkling water. Stir gently to mix.

  4. Garnish and Serve
    Garnish with a lemon or yuzu slice and a sprig of mint. Serve cold and bubbly.


Tips

  • Yuzu juice can be found at Asian markets or online — a little goes a long way.

  • Add a few basil leaves or shiso for a herbal twist.

  • For a frozen treat, blend the yuzu mix with crushed ice for a yuzu slushie.
